Exploring the Potential of Metal–Organic Frameworks for Cryogenic Helium-Based Gas Gap Heat Switches via High-Throughput Computational Screening
Published 2024“…<i>v</i><sub>sor</sub> and <i>q</i><sub>tot</sub> generally change in the same direction, which implies it is possible to reduce both parameters simultaneously by choosing a suitable MOF. Structure–performance analysis reveals that 1/<i>v</i><sub>sor</sub> consistently increases first and then decreases with pore limiting diameter, largest cavity diameter, available pore volume, accessible surface area, helium void fraction, and bulk density. …”
